Son Tung "slows down", continues to release a new version of "There's No One At All"
As soon as it was released by Son Tung M-TP on the evening of April 28, the MV There's No One At All caused a fierce controversy. The negative lyrics and images in this MV, especially the image of Son Tung M-TP jumping off a building because he was too stuck in life, were heavily criticized.
Right after that, the Department of Radio and Television (Ministry of Information and Communications) coordinated with the Department of Performing Arts (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ism) to handle this MV. On the evening of April 29, Son Tung apologized on his personal page and announced that he would stop releasing the MV There's No One At All , but only locked the MV in the Vietnamese market.
On May 5, the male singer's representative came to work with the inspector of the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ism in Hanoi. After the meeting, the inspector of the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ism issued a decision to impose a fine of 70 million VND and asked Son Tung's company to destroy the MV; return the illegal profits obtained from the commission of violations; remove audio and video recordings of MV There's No One At All in electronic form on the network and digital environment.
